Long story short, factory backup camera to my Pioneer HU that I had for 6 years stopped working. After much troubleshooting, I came to conclusion that it is the HU to blame as everything works fine with factory NAV (more details in another post on here). Anyways, while everything is working with stock setup, I now have front camera with nowhere to connect it to. I made home-made harness from factory radio harness to my front camera and backup camera via AV switcher ( https://www.ebay.com/itm/2-to-1-Channel-RCA-Video-Intelligent-Switcher-for-Car-/112692092202 ) to factory NAV with latching switch for front camera activation. All is working. However, all is working ONLY when shifted to reverse. I need to bypass to get front camera to work whenever I want to with a switch. Does anyone know what wire or what exactly triggers the factory NAV to switch to backup camera mode? I am attempting to bypass that with providing contact to reverse wire PIN on factory NAV to make front camera work (at least that's the intent). Thanks.

probably the reverse light power signal. you can wire a diode into the signal wire now and add a switched 12v source on the radio side of that switch. when the switch is on it will stop the 12v from backfeeding to its original source signal. just make sure the diode is facing the correct direction. you can also add a nc relay onto the new switched signal with the relay trigger being the original signal source. that way if you forget the switch on and place the vehicle in reverse it will break the power from the new 12v signal. both of those will stop backfeeding and sending 2 12v signals into the same source.

These trucks don't use a reverse lead to switch the HU to camera. It is done via the canbus data line.

Just FYI.
